Optic Nerve
The nerve that transmits visual information from the retina to the brain.
Retina
The light-sensitive layer of tissue at the back of the inner eye that converts light images into nerve signals sent to the brain.
Conjunctiva
The thin, transparent membrane that covers the white part of the eyeball and the inner surfaces of the eyelids.
Iris
The colored part of the eye surrounding the pupil, responsible for controlling the amount of light entering the eye.
